Gay/Straight Student Alliances (GSAs)

Twenty-One of the area middle & high schools now have gay student groups (or alliances) that provide support for teens on those respective campuses. Yes.. you read that right: MIDDLE school—see Doolen Middle School below. These clubs usually welcome straight, gay-friendly, and questioning teens to meetings. Contact these schools (or the National web-site of GLSEN or GLSEN Arizona — Tucson) for more information on how they set up their student group/club and start the process of getting a group at your school! Support your school's Gay/Straight Alliance--attend meetings!

"Voices of GLBT Youth"

GLSEN of Tucson sponsored the creation and distribution of a video titled,"Voices of GLBT Youth" that features interviews of local, Tucson GLBT youth telling their stories about being gay in high school. The above link is to a streaming video version made available by the video production company, PanLeft Productions. In addition, every high school in Tucson (with or without a GSA) should have received a VHS copy of the video. New copies of the video will be distributed in DVD format in the future.
